National Health Service NHS
The primary alternative in the UK is the NHS, which provides comprehensive healthcare services, including diagnostic tests, free at the point of use for all eligible residents.
- Free Service: The most significant advantage is that all medically necessary tests are provided without direct cost to the patient.
- GP Referral: Tests are typically initiated by a GP referral, ensuring medical oversight and integration into a broader healthcare plan.
- Waiting Times: The main drawback can be longer waiting times for appointments and results, especially for non-urgent tests, which Medical-diagnosis.net seeks to address. However, for urgent cases, the NHS prioritizes rapid diagnosis and treatment.

vs. NHS National Health Service
This is the most common comparison, as the NHS is the primary healthcare provider in the UK. Wharfedaleexteriorcleaning.co.uk Reviews
- Cost:
- Medical-diagnosis.net: Paid service, prices clearly listed per test. For example, a Comprehensive Profile costs £108.00.
- NHS: Free at the point of use for eligible residents.
- Speed:
- Medical-diagnosis.net: Emphasizes rapid results, often within 4 hours for many tests, and no waiting lists for appointments.
- NHS: Can involve significant waiting times for non-urgent appointments and results, though urgent cases are prioritized. In 2023, NHS waiting lists for diagnostic tests in England often exceeded six weeks for routine referrals.
- Access:
- Medical-diagnosis.net: Direct access. no GP referral needed to book a test. Limited to specific London locations for sample collection.
- NHS: Requires a GP referral for most tests, widely accessible through local clinics and hospitals across the UK.
- Interpretation & Follow-up:
- Medical-diagnosis.net: Provides raw results. interpretation and follow-up consultation with a GP are user’s responsibility.
- NHS: Tests are part of an integrated care pathway, with GP consultation for interpretation, diagnosis, and treatment planning.
